Role Overview
Build and operate AI and process automation solutions across Finance, Tax, Human Capital, Legal and Compliance, Marketing and Communications, and other Corporate Services functions.
Embed with business stakeholders to turn ambiguous business problems into working software and production products.
Own delivery outcomes for the products built and serve as a trusted technical partner to business stakeholders.
Solution Delivery
- Scope and ship AI and automation products with business stakeholders.
- Own discovery, requirements, build, deployment, adoption, and iteration.
- Build agentic workflows, LLM-powered analytics, document intelligence pipelines, and human-in-the-loop copilots.
- Automate high-volume processes from intake and data capture through approvals, exceptions, and downstream systems.
- Prototype in days, harden in weeks, and operate solutions at firm scale.
- Partner with users in their environment to deliver solutions they will use.
Engineering Craft and Reusability
- Write production-quality code and apply code review, testing, deployment hygiene, monitoring, and incremental hardening.
- Use Claude Code, Cursor, and the surrounding DevOps stack effectively.
- Build reusable components, evaluation harnesses, prompt and agent patterns, and deployment templates.
- Partner with infrastructure, data, and security teams to meet observability, control, and audit standards.
- Stay current on AI tools, models, and techniques and bring promising options to the team.
In-Office Requirement
- The role requires working in the office four days per week.
Education and Certifications
- Bachelor's degree is required.
- A concentration in computer science, software engineering, mathematics, physics, data science, or a related technical field is preferred.
- Master's degree is preferred.
Professional Experience
- Five or more years of overall relevant hands-on engineering experience is required.
- Two or more years building and shipping production AI applications to real users is required.
- Fluency with AI coding agents, developer tools, version control, CI/CD, testing, containerization, and cloud deployment.
- Experience with structured and unstructured data at scale, document intelligence, OCR, LLM-based extraction, and workflow automation.
- Strong coding fundamentals in Python and TypeScript or Java, with comfort across Spark transforms and React front ends.
- Experience working directly with business users in regulated, high-stakes environments. Financial services experience is preferred but not required.
Benefits and Compensation
- The stated base salary range for the Washington, DC role is $160,000 to $180,000.
- The role may include benefits and eligibility for an annual discretionary incentive program.
